To prevent the automatic shutdown during a failure, could you do the following?

Access your advanced system settings via right-clicking your computer>Select the Settings in the Startup and Recovery Section (Lower part of the window)> Uncheck, under System Failure, Automatically Restart. Make sure that "Write an Event To the System Log" remains checked.

Just thought i would update you on the situation. A friend of mine told me he also had lots of BSOD's a while ago, and what he did to fix it was to plug in the SATA cables into diffirent sockets on the motherboard. I did that and I haven't crashed in about 4 days now which almost sounds too good to be true in my ears :)
